What is the point of half cocking a pistol?
Half-cocking a pistol is a safety measure utilized in firearms with a hammer to prevent accidental discharge. When a pistol is half-cocked, the hammer is partially drawn back and locked in place. This prevents the hammer from striking the firing pin or primer, reducing the risk of the firearm discharging accidentally if the trigger is pulled or if the gun is dropped. The half-cocked position serves as an additional safety feature when the gun is not in use but still loaded.

Are 9mm suppressors legal?
The legality of 9mm suppressors depends on the country and, in the United States, on state law. In the U.S., suppressors are legal under federal law but are regulated by the National Firearms Act (NFA). To legally own a suppressor, you must:
1. Be at least 21 years old to purchase from a dealer (18 if buying from a private party, where legal).
2. Meet all federal and state eligibility requirements to own a firearm.
3. Reside in one of the states where suppressor ownership is legal.
4. Fill out an ATF Form 4 application.
5. Submit fingerprints and a photograph.
6. Pay a one-time $200 tax stamp.
7. Pass an extensive background check.
Not all states allow suppressors, and some have additional regulations. Always verify the current laws in your specific location or consult with a legal expert to ensure compliance.

Is a CZ 75 drop safe?
The CZ 75 pistol is generally considered to have a solid design, but it does not have a dedicated drop safety mechanism like some modern pistols. The safety features of the CZ 75, such as the manual safety and the firing pin block (on newer models), contribute to its overall safety. However, because it lacks a specific drop safety, it may not be as “drop safe” as some pistols that are explicitly designed with this feature. It’s important to handle any firearm with care to prevent accidental discharge, especially when dropped. For specific safety information, consulting the manufacturer’s guidelines or a firearms expert is recommended.
